.filters__sort-by{width:20%}.select{background:transparent;border:1px solid #b6b6b6;display:block;font-size:.9rem;height:32px;outline:none;width:100%}.offer-row__name{display:inline-block;font-size:1.2em;margin:0;width:40%}.offer-row__hotel-id{font-size:.5em}.offer-row__date,.offer-row__location{display:inline-block;width:20%}.offer-row__last-price{display:inline-block;text-align:right;width:10%}.offer-row__last-price-value{display:block}.offer-row__last-price-date{display:block;font-size:9px}.offer-row__date,.offer-row__last-price,.offer-row__location,.offer-row__name{display:inline-block;vertical-align:middle}.offer-row__bar{padding:5px 0}.offer-row__details{padding:0 0 5px;position:relative}.offer-row__chart{padding-bottom:30%;position:relative;width:100%}.offer-row__chart-container{height:100%;left:0;position:absolute;top:0;width:100%}.offer-row__chart-canvas{height:100%;width:100%}.offer-row__offer-id{display:block;font-size:12px;margin-bottom:1em}.spinner{margin:0 auto;width:100px}.offers-view{margin:0 auto;max-width:1024px}.offers-list{list-style:none;margin:0;padding:0}.offers-list__item{border-bottom:1px solid #b6b6b6;margin:0}